Specifications
- Material: Utilizes high-quality materials such as ceramic (COG) to ensure stability, low losses, and excellent electrical properties for consistent performance.
- Capacitance: With a capacitance value of 510pF, this component is suitable for applications requiring specific electrical characteristics and signal processing requirements.
- Tolerance: Manufactured with a tolerance of ±5% to maintain accuracy and reliability in circuit operations.
- Voltage Rating: Rated at 50V, providing sufficient voltage handling capacity for various electronic applications.
Applications
- Electronic Circuits: Ideal for use in precision circuits, filters, timing circuits, and other electronic systems where stable capacitance and low losses are essential.
- Communication Systems: Suitable for applications in RF filters, oscillators, and signal processing where consistent performance is critical.
- Medical Devices: Used in medical equipment requiring reliable and stable electronic components for accurate functionality.
